QuickScan Reviews in Pediatric Dentistry, May 30 2009

Background: We continually look for better ways to slow down or hopefully even arrest the caries process. It is well known that oxygen, particularly in the form of ozone, can be effective in reducing the number of or even killing cariogenic microflora. Recently, a device had been developed to manufacture and deliver ozone in situ, on the tooth, with the intention of killing the caries-causing bugs and thereby halting the progression of demineralization. Objective: To evaluate the HealozoneTM device in terms of its ability to kill a variety of cariogenic organisms based on delivery time of the ozone and whether or not the surface treated was contaminated with saliva. Methods: Caries-causing bacteria of the genera Actinomyces , Lactobacilli , and Streptococcus in either a buffered saline solution or in saliva were treated with 10-, 30or 60-second exposures of ozone and were cultivated on agar plates in vitro. The percentage of bacteria of each of the genera with the various treatment times, and with or without saliva contamination was calculated. Results: After 10 seconds of exposure to ozone, the vast majority of bacteria of each type were killed. After 10 or 30 seconds of exposure, the Lactobacilli and Streptococcus types of bacteria were less efficiently killed when contaminated with saliva, but after 60 seconds, even with saliva contamination, nearly all bacteria were killed. The results of this study are consistent with those of many other in vitro studies and a few clinical studies that have examined the killing effect of the Healozone device on cariogenic bacteria. Other work has also shown that removal of debris and biofilm from the surface has aided not only in kill rates of the microflora, but also in halting progression of existing caries demineralization. Work by Lynch and others has, in several clinical instances, shown that even when leathery-type demineralization was exhibited clinically and was subsequently treated with the Healozone device, progression of lesions can be halted. Some early work has even shown reversal of lesions in the form of increase in dentin microhardness suggesting remineralization. Conclusions/Reviewer's Comments: The present study shows only the core potential of the Healozone device to kill caries-causing bacteria. This work combined with the work of other studies showing the need to debride the surface might yield better clinical findings in a study designed to test the combined effect of some caries-affected tooth structure removal combined with ozone therapy. In considering better ways to treat the earliest manifestations of early childhood caries on the lingual surface of primary incisors, this combined technique might yield benefit.

Management of children with hereditary angioedema: a report of two cases.

Dentists must take extreme care in treating patients with Hereditary Angioedema (HAE). Physical trauma, emotional stress, or anxiety during dental treatment could lead to an acute attack that may lead to a laryngeal obstruction. This article reviews clinical signs and symptoms, disease classification, pathophysiology, and treatment recommendations for HAE. Management of 2 patients with HAE is a...
